为什么用vue的程序员
-
使用Vue的程序员有以下几个主要原因:
-
简单易学:Vue是一种基于JavaScript的前端框架,相比其他框架如Angular和React,Vue的学习曲线较为平缓,开发者可以比较容易地上手并快速开始开发。Vue的语法简洁明了,易于理解和编写,适合初学者。
-
可组件化开发:Vue采用组件化的开发模式,将应用拆分为多个独立的组件,每个组件有自己的状态和行为。这种方式使得代码可复用性和可维护性更高,有助于团队协作开发以及项目的扩展和维护。
-
响应式数据绑定:Vue提供了一种便捷的数据绑定方式,通过在模板中使用双向绑定语法,使得数据的变化能够实时地同步到视图上,同时也能够自动更新相关的数据。这种响应式的特性,使得开发者可以更加高效地处理复杂的UI交互逻辑。
-
插件和生态系统:Vue拥有丰富的插件和生态系统,为开发者提供了大量的解决方案和功能扩展。可以通过插件来扩展Vue的功能,如Vuex用于状态管理、Vue Router用于路由管理等。同时,Vue还支持和其他库和框架的无缝集成,如Element UI和Vuetify用于开发美观的UI界面。
-
活跃的社区支持:Vue有一个活跃的开源社区,开发者可以在社区中获取到丰富的资源和帮助。社区中有很多优秀的开源项目和示例代码可以供开发者参考和学习,同时也有很多经验丰富的开发者愿意分享自己的经验和解决方案。
总之,使用Vue的程序员有着简单易学、可组件化开发、响应式数据绑定、插件和生态系统、活跃的社区支持等优势,使得Vue成为很多程序员的首选框架。
2年前 -
-
-
简单易学:Vue.js是一个简洁、灵活的JavaScript框架,它采用了类似于HTML的语法,使得程序员可以更加轻松地上手使用。相比于其他框架如React或Angular,Vue.js的学习曲线较为平缓,因此对于初学者来说是一个很好的选择。
-
方便快捷的开发:Vue.js拥有一套完善的工具链,使得开发者能够高效地开发单页面应用程序。它提供了响应式的数据绑定和组件系统,能够更好地管理和复用代码,提高开发效率。同时,Vue.js还提供了易于测试和调试的开发工具,使得开发更加便捷。
-
生态丰富:Vue.js拥有一个活跃的社区,有大量的第三方插件和库可供选择。这些插件和库可以帮助程序员扩展Vue.js的功能,提供更多的解决方案。此外,Vue.js与其他流行的工具和框架如webpack、Vuex和Vue Router等可以无缝集成,使得整个开发过程更加丰富多样。
-
跨平台开发:Vue.js不仅可以用于Web开发,还可以用于移动端开发。Vue.js结合了Cordova或Ionic等混合开发框架,可以轻松实现将代码打包成原生应用程序,使得程序员可以一次编写,多端运行。这种跨平台开发的能力,大大提高了开发效率和开发者的工作负担。
-
社区支持强大:Vue.js有一个强大的社区支持,拥有丰富的文档、教程和社区论坛。无论遇到什么问题,都可以通过社区来寻求帮助和交流。此外,Vue.js还定期发布新版本,修复漏洞和改进功能,保证了框架的稳定性和持续发展。
2年前 -
-
Vue.js是一种轻量级的JavaScript框架,被广泛应用于现代Web应用程序的开发中。Vue.js具有以下几个优点,这也是为什么很多程序员选择使用Vue.js的原因:
-
简单易学:Vue.js的语法简单明了,相较于其他框架,上手和学习成本较低。Vue.js采用了基于组件的开发模式,组件是应用程序中的可重用代码块,在Vue.js中可以轻松创建和使用组件。
-
易于集成:Vue.js可以与其他现有的JavaScript库和框架无缝集成,不需要进行大量的重构。这使得开发人员可以将Vue.js与他们喜欢的工具和库结合使用,提高开发效率。
-
响应式设计:Vue.js采用了响应式设计的原则,能够自动追踪数据的变化,当数据发生改变时,Vue.js会自动更新相关的DOM元素,从而保持应用程序与数据的同步。这种响应式的设计思想,使得Vue.js可以实现更快速、流畅的用户界面交互。
-
双向数据绑定:Vue.js提供了双向数据绑定的功能,将数据模型和视图之间的关联进行自动化处理。这意味着当数据发生变化时,视图会自动更新;同时,当用户在视图中进行输入时,数据模型也会自动更新。这大大简化了数据的处理和操作,提高了开发效率。
-
插件生态系统:Vue.js拥有一个庞大的插件生态系统,开发人员可以根据自己的需求选择适合的插件来扩展Vue.js的功能。这些插件可以用来处理路由、表单验证、数据请求等常见的开发需求,从而进一步提高开发效率。
总结起来,Vue.js具有易学、易集成、响应式设计、双向数据绑定和丰富的插件生态系统等优势,这使得它成为了很多程序员的首选框架。同时,Vue.js还具有活跃的社区和完善的文档支持,开发者可以通过各种资源来获取帮助和学习。
2年前 -